Job Description

The Contract Specialist position will be responsible for supporting CP Contract Specialist activities specific to Scotford, CP Site Projects and will report to the CP Site Project Lead.

Value

  • Develop commercially competitive contracting & procurement strategies per project and recognize opportunities to consolidate multiple project strategies, forecast demand, and yearly outlooks into wider category strategies across the portfolio to deliver the most competitive projects. These strategies are to meet the Business Demand while considering the potential implementation of Global Strategies at the local/regional level.
  • Conduct tenders, evaluate bids & drive negotiations with Suppliers in accordance to the CMCP while managing expectations related to meeting project timelines and TCO drivers.
  • Ensure delivery & effectively manage contracts while continuously driving value improvement targets and process efficiency.
  • Identify, develop & implement supply chain improvement opportunities.

Company Description

In Canada, we do everything from exploring for oil and gas, to refining and manufacturing, to discovering new ways to reduce emissions, to delivering fuels to our customers from coast to coast.

We have many successful businesses and projects across Canada, including:

  • a strong and rapidly growing Upstream business built around the Montney and the Duvernay shale plays, on a foundation of Foothills sour gas;
  • a successful Downstream business anchored in our Sarnia refinery (Ontario) and our Scotford refinery and upgrader (Alberta) as well as our two world-class petrochemicals plants near Edmonton;
  • a network of 1,300 retail sites across Canada – a vital point of connection for our customers to us – which makes us one of the pre-eminent fuel retailers in the country;
  • strong Aviation, Sulphur and Lubricants businesses;
  • an innovative Supply and Trading business;
  • a prospective LNG export project in Kitimat, B.C.

Canada is especially well-suited to offer lower carbon energy solutions thanks to our highly experienced workforce, our abundance of natural resources and supportive government policies. In Canada, Shell is actively exploring opportunities to invest in new fuels for transport, renewable power and customer solutions enabled by digital technology to lead the global movement towards cleaner energy.
